Pros

Transmax is a good company with some great, talented and dedicated staff. Their product is decades old but nonetheless impressive and forever evolving as it should. The work environment is relaxed, inclusive and well managed. The office is also well located and modern. For all of these reasons it's a good company.

Cons

Where the company is let down is with senior management. The CEO's role has been a revolving door, with the current leader stood down pending an investigation into misusing company funds. Staff are generally well underpaid, yet stories of perks and lavish excess at the top don't do well for general morale. Its also like a ghost town at the business end of the building on Fridays. Again, not a good look.

Pros

- Some highly skilled and intelligent 'diamond in the rough' staff who do their very best to survive and make the days of their colleagues better - Morning tea provided once a week

Cons

- Nepotism like you've never seen before and a 'jobs for the boys/girls' culture, very strong cliques and silos, some very bitter staff, finger-pointing and blaming is rife - Non-existent training and induction - Many senior and/or long-term staff seem to have a superiority complex that borders on bullying, this does not breed an inclusive and helpful workplace, instead giving more of a 'high school' feel. - Unengaged, unskilled and personally ill-equipped team leaders and management who are out of touch - Government-owned business pretending not to be Government-owned - Complete disregard for the mental health of many staff - Entire business revolves around a horribly outdated piece of software that is not keeping pace with the market, this business may become irrelevant soon - Extremely high staff turnover rate
